Mr. Alfred Rogers fought in the World War II and has had quite a life. In February 2022, he reached an important milestone when he turned 100 years old. His family organized a lovely birthday party for him and he was astounded by the beautiful gesture.

“There are not many times in my life I have been speechless, but this may be as close as I’ll ever get,” Rogers said, as per 11 Alive News. “I can’t tell you how much I appreciate this. This is something I’ll never forget.”

Source: YouTube

Speaking of everything he achieved during the course of his long and fulfilling life, Mr. Rogers said one of the best things he has ever experienced is getting to hold his great-granddaughter in his arms. “I got to hold my first great-grand baby,” the proud great-grandfather revealed. “She’s a 3-month-old little girl.”

Mr. Rogers’ daughter, Betsy Rogers, says she can’t believe her father turned 100 years old.

“It doesn’t feel like 100 years because he does so well. He still lives independently, he still drives,” she said. “He’s tough, he’s loving and highly intelligent.”

Source: YouTube

As for Mr. Rogers, he says he can’t wait to travel with his camper to a new destination, which is something he loves doing.

Having a sibling means having a friend for life. Brothers and sisters are those special individuals we can always rely on when things get hard and the first people to share our happiness with.

Bridger Walker and his four-year-old sister were at a friend’s backyard having fun when a German Shepherd tried to attack the girl. Without thinking twice, then 6-year-old Bridger jumped in front of her and acted as a shield. The girl wasn’t hurt in any way, but Bridger got severely bitten on the face. He was left with multiple scars and needed 90 stitches for the open wound to be repaired.

Source: Facebook

Today, a year and a half after the vicious attack, Bridger says he’s proud of his scar because it shows that he did what every brother needs to do and that is to protect his younger siblings. “If someone had to die, I thought it should be me,” the brave boy was reported saying at the time.

Speaking of his son’s selfless act and the scar he has on his face, Bridger’s father, Robert Walker, told People:

“My wife and I asked him, ‘Do you want it to go away?’ And he said, ‘I don’t want it to go all the way away.’

“Bridger views his scar as something to be proud of, but he also doesn’t see it as being representative of his brave act. He just perceives it as, ‘I was a brother and that’s what brothers do.’ It’s a reminder that his sister didn’t get hurt, and that she is okay.”

The story of Bridger’s bravery came to light after his aunt Nikki shared it online. “My nephew is a hero who saved his little sister from an attacking dog,” she wrote.

“He, himself, took on the attack so that the dog wouldn’t get his sister. He later said, ‘If someone was going to die, I thought it should be me.’ He got home from the hospital last night. I know it’s a long shot, but I’m reaching out to the Avengers and other heroes so that they can learn about this latest addition to their ranks.”

To her and Bridger’s surprise, Robert Downey Jr. who played Iron Man and Chris Evans who portrays the role of Captain America both responded with videos in which they praised Bridger’s act.

The boy, however, although happy with the superheroes’ videos, said what he did wasn’t heroic, he just acted the way every older brother should act during such a terrifying situation.

“It almost bothers him sometimes when he’s called a hero, because he [thinks], ‘Maybe I could have done more to shield her,’” the boy’s dad said.

“Chris Evans, his video was amazing and he sent the shield. Bridger couldn’t have been more delighted,” the dad added. “When he talked to Tom Holland, he was probably the most starstruck because that was a live call so that one certainly left an impression… His emotional recovery was really a worldwide effort and that was so special to us.”

Although Bridger’s face now looks better after all the surgeries, he needs to undergo more in the future.

“We still have a little bit more work to do on the superficial, redness part of it, but structurally everything looks so much better,” said Dr. Dhaval Bhanusali who offered to fly Bridger to his office in New York and provide treatment for free. “I always told Robert, ‘When Bridger’s in junior high or high school, I want this to be a story he tells, not a memory he has to relive every day.’ And I think we will have that situation,” the kind doctor added.

Other celebs who reached to Bridger, among the rest, are Mark Ruffalo and Anne Hathaway.

Angela ”Big Ang” Raiola became a huge star when she first appeared on the reality show Mob Wives which captivated the attention of a huge audience.

All of the women who were part of the show were somehow related to the families which controlled the mafia in New York City. Big Ang was the niece of the late Salvatore ”Sally Dogs” Lombardi, one of the “capos” of the notorious Genovese crime family. Besides being famous for her larger-than-life personality and brash demeanor, Big Ang was also known for her plastic surgeries and her distinctive looks; her huge boobs and lips among the rest.

In 2001, Big Ang was arrested in Brooklyn when she tried to sell drugs to undercover cops. She was 41 at the time and was actively involved in the work of the mafia. Her role was distributing drugs on ”street-level.”

As the leader who Big Ang worked for was sentenced to 13 years in prison, she was sentenced to three years’ probation in 2003.

”People ask me why I did it. I was a single mom, supporting my family, paying $3,000 in rent. I did it for the money. I wouldn’t do it again and haven’t since. I learned my lesson,” Big Ang explained back in the day.

She had a hard time spending four months in house arrest because she was a kind of person who wanted to be in the center of attention and loved partying. Because she couldn’t go out, she decided to bring the party to her and organized sleepovers and parties.

”My girlfriends and family came by every day. That also made me feel less claustrophobic. But for someone like me who needs to be where the action is and loves to go out, being confined to one place was torture,” she explained.

She even released a book in which she gave her readers tips on how to kill boredom among the rest.

Mob Wives was praised by critics and reached huge popularity. Ken Tucker, a TV critic on Entertainment Weekly, wrote: ”As someone who’s watched at least a few episodes of every version of the Real Housewives franchise and feels a bit nauseous about it, I didn’t come to Mob Wives with high hopes. But this floridly funny, vicariously vicious reality series exerts a vulgar charm.”

Big Ang stole the hearts of millions of people and was offered spin-offs during which she revealed a lot about her life.

Big Ang was diagnosed with cancer when doctors discovered a lemon-size tumor in her throat after she complained of neck pain in 2015. She had undergone a surgery but was later diagnosed with stage four breast and lung cancer. ”First I thought I was cancer free. I was going to have a big party. Then a month later I was stage 4,” Angela explained towards the end of her life.

The last time she appeared on TV was for the reunion of Mob Wives when she spent two hours on set but was forced to drag herself there.

When it came to her private life, Big Ang was married to Neil Murphy but their relationship wasn’t a picture-perfect one. She had two daughters and six grandchildren.

Shortly before her passing, Big Ang appeared on Dr. Oz and opened up about her life. ”I felt like he never stepped up to the plate, so I was done with it,” she said of her husband. “Now, it’s too late. I would rather be by myself. I would rather be alone.”

A couple from Italy, Martina Russo and Fil, were on the road and driving through Spain’s countryside when they saw a tiny dog running after their vehicle. They found it fun at first because they thought the sweet canine was playing but they soon realized that the reason behind the running was in fact a heartbreaking one.

As the dog was trying to get to the couple, they decided to pull over. They took the dog in their arms and believed it was lost, but as no one was around and there weren’t any houses nearby, they assumed it was either lost or someone abandoned it.

“We… took her to the nearest village to ask if someone had lost her, but no one had ever seen her before,” Martina wrote on Instagram. “We are in the middle of nowhere, no houses or other human life in a long range.

“On the way back we put her back where we found her, thinking she might know to walk back, but she followed us again until we got to the van.”

Martina posted photos of the dog on social media asking if someone was looking for her. A few weeks passed by and no one came forward so they decided to adopt her.

“We took her to the vet the next day, and turns out she was not chipped, not spayed, female, about one-year-old, fur very overgrown and full of gunk around the eyes,” Martina told SWNS.

They named her Moxie and gave her a loving home.

“She’s very sweet and funny, very playful, loves our cats — to be fair, she loves everything and everyone!” Martina said. “We love taking her on adventures, and she makes us laugh every day.

“Every day is a new adventure for Moxie now.”

As she was dropping off the students home after classes, she suddenly noticed how the brake light on the bus came on. It did raise concern but she believed she could make it to the fourth stop before she pulled over and made a further examination. But it turned out the problem was way more serious than she assumed as they all smelled smoke.

Renita said: “By the time I picked up the mic to call transportation, my bus was on fire.”

Thanks to her quick thinking and her readiness to act in such situations, Renita managed to get the kids off the bus. Some of the neighbors who witnessed the accident helped get the children to safety. Renita, however, wanted to make sure no one was left behind and then did something truly amazing. She got back into the bus that was all in flames just to make sure no kid was still inside.

Smith says, “Then I ran back into the bus because I needed to make sure that all of my babies were accounted for.”

This lady was ready to put her life on the line as long as her babies were safe and sound. The story of her bravery spread among people from all over the country. Everyone praised Renita for her action, but the one person who was truly fascinated by this woman’s fearlessness was Ellen DeGeneres. The comedian and a host show learned how Renita didn’t have an easy life as she struggled to make ends meet so she invited her over at the show and this single mom got the surprise of her life.

Naomi Judd, one of the best and most prominent country music singers looks as beautiful as always as the age of 76. Although she has stayed out of the spotlight in recent years, Naomi’s career influenced the world of country music a great deal and she was inducted into the Country Music Hall of Fame in 2021 as a member of The Judds alongside her daughter Wynonna.

Naomi gave birth to her daughter Wynonna a week before she was supposed to graduate from high school. Being a mother at 18 wasn’t easy, let alone a single mom. Her boyfriend left Naomi because he wasn’t ready to be a father so she was forced to raise her daughter all by herself. Some time after welcoming Wynonna into her life, Naomi met Michael Ciminiella whom she married in 1964. Four years after tying the knot, Naomi gave birth to her second daughter, renown actress Ashley Judd. Unfortunately, Naomi’s union with Ciminiella didn’t last long and she was once again left to take care of her children alone.

Ebet Roberts/Redferns

Raising two girls wasn’t easy. The family struggled to make ends meet and lived in a cottage in Kentucky where they didn’t have telephone or television. As the place often lacked electricity as well, Wynonna spent most of her time learning how to play the guitar. Over time, she became very good at it and became obsessed with music.

As life in rural Kentucky was a difficult one, Naomi and her girls moved to California where she enrolled a nursing school. She did all in her power to provide a decent life for her daughters and worked as a waitress while attending school.

“There were times when I didn’t know how we were gonna eat, or how I was even gonna pay the small rent that I paid… It still amazes me how I did it,” Naomi said of that tough period of her life.

Once she received her diploma, Naomi and her daughters found a place to stay in Nashville where she found a job as a head nurse in an ICU.

One day while on the job, Naomi met someone who helped change her life forever.

A patient at the hospital happened to be a man whose father was a record producer who arranged for Naomi and Wynonna to get to a live audition at the music label RCA in Nashville in 1983 and that was the start of something huge.

Speaking of that audition and singing in front of the producers, Wynonna revealed later on:

“It felt very much like going to the principal’s office,” Wynonna Judd recalled. “I was used to singing; I wasn’t used to being in a boardroom full of men. Joe remembers me taking my guitar out of its case just like it was a gun in a holster.

“I could sing in front of 10,000 people, as long as I had my guitar. I was like ‘Xena’ with a guitar. It was my protection, it was my weapon. It was my best friend, it was my purpose for anything and anybody.”

Naomi and Wynonna signed their first record and released their first album Wynonna & Naomi, as The Judds. The world became fascinated with the mother-daughter duo. They released number one hits and sold records for more than $20 million.

Wynonna was tough as a teenager and her relationship with her mother wasn’t always a smooth one. They weren’t great at communicating with one another through words, but music was a different thing. It helped them bond on a different level.

“It happened because of country music, because of the fans. There was never any great epiphany for us to say, ‘Okay, I get it, I understand your reality—you weren’t trying to destroy my life,’” Naomi Judd recalled in an interview with Ability Magazine. “It was just a gradual evolution, and when you share a dressing room, a stage, a hotel room, and you sleep six feet away from each other on the Silver Eagle Bus, you will either work it out, or you’ll kill each other.”

“A very interesting thing began to change when we’d be on stage. I would look out at the sea of smiling faces and sense that they were scrutinizing Wy and me, and that put us on our best behavior,” she added. “There was a real symbiotic relationship taking place at that time. Fans would come to us for advice.”

Ed Rode/Getty Images

At the age of 44, Naomi was diagnosed with Hepatitis C and doctors said she had 3 years to live at most so she and Wynonna had what they believed would be their last tour together. However, Naomi became a medically documented miracle. She was cured and decided to share her incredible life story with people from all over the country by becoming a motivational speaker.

Today, she’s living a quiet life with her husband of 32 years, Larry Strickland.

Chase and Sadie’s love story is one of the most touching and most beautiful ones we’ve ever stumbled upon. Although they were still just teenagers, they loved each other unconditionally and dreamed of staying together forever.

They both believed life was ahead of them, but then, Chase learned he had cancer. Their world collapsed. Their hearts were filled with sorrow. But they decided to pray and hope for the best and use their time together as best as they could.

As his illness progressed, he proposed to Sadie and the two tied the knot during an intimate ceremony in the presence of their parents. This wonderful couple exchanged their vows at Sadie’s yard which was decorated with balloons and flowers. Because of the pandemic, they couldn’t invite many people, but Chase’s father made sure all those people who supported Chase and Sadie be there with them virtually. He shared an emotional video of the newlyweds on YouTube.

They planned the wedding in four days and everything went perfect.

Chase’s mom was over the moon that her son’s wish of marrying the woman of his dreams came true. She compared the young couple’s love story with those from Nicholas Spark’s novels or a Hallmark movie.

In an attempt to help Chase with his cancer, a GoFundMe page was started. Sadly, almost a year after the wedding, he had undergone scans which showed that the tumors spread. In April of 2021, Chase passed away.

The money raised was used for the medical and funeral expenses and the rest was donated to causes which Chase held near and dear to his heart. Rest in peace, young man, you are dearly missed.

Joani and Trevion Clemons, a couple from Atlanta, Georgia, made headlines after their incredible life story went viral some years ago.

These two first met and fell in love with each other when they were still just teenagers but they both knew they were meant for one another. After tying the knot, they welcomed four beautiful daughters together.

Source: YouTube

Although their family of six seemed complete, the Clemons wanted more children. However, once Joani was diagnosed with polycystic ovary syndrome, or PCOS, doctors told her she wouldn’t be able to conceive again.

Nine years after welcoming their youngest child, Joani felt a lump in her breast and visited a doctor. However, she never expected the visit to take such an unexpected turn.

“I went in because breast cancer runs in our family and I had a lump in my breast,” Joani told WSBTV. “That’s when [the doctor] told me that was a milk gland.”

The doctor who once told her she couldn’t get pregnant was the same one who gave her the happy news.

The real surprise came after Joani’s ultrasound. She wasn’t carrying one baby, but three. The pregnancy came with certain complications, but at the end everything went well and Joani gave birth to three healthy baby boys who were born three weeks prematurely. They weighted around 3 pounds each and needed to stay at the hospital for 10 long weeks before they went home.

The family of six turned into a family of nine. Devon, Bryce and Miles are now all grown up but it’s always nice to go back to their story and see how they are doing nowadays.
